The Design Story: Snoop Dogg Blowing Olympic Rings

The pin’s design captures something truly remarkable about Snoop’s Olympic presence. The central image features his distinctive silhouette in profile, meticulously crafted in high-quality enamel that brings depth and vibrancy to the piece. What makes this design genuinely captivating is how the five Olympic rings appear as stylized smoke billowing from his mouth, creating a visual metaphor that’s both playful and profound.

The craftsmanship reflects optimal attention to detail, with each Olympic ring maintaining its traditional colors while seamlessly integrating into the smoke-like design. The metal backing, typically measuring approximately 1.5 inches (3.8 centimeters) in diameter, provides durability and substantial weight that collectors appreciate. Why This Pin Isn’t Officially IOC-Licensed

Understanding the pin’s unofficial status helps explain both its scarcity and pricing dynamics. The International Olympic Committee maintains strict licensing requirements for any merchandise bearing Olympic symbols. Since this pin wasn’t produced through official IOC channels, it operates in what’s essentially a grey market for Olympic memorabilia.

This unofficial status means production was limited and distribution occurred through alternative channels rather than traditional Olympic merchandise outlets. The restricted availability has significantly impacted pricing, with values fluctuating based on demand from collectors and fans. For buyers, this means exercising extra caution when assessing authenticity.

Pricing Analysis: What You Should Expect to Pay

The market for this distinctive collectible demonstrates fascinating dynamics of limited-edition memorabilia pricing. Understanding these factors helps collectors make informed decisions and recognize fair market values.

Current Market Value Range ($75-$300+)

Base pricing typically starts around $75-$100 for standard condition pins acquired through secondary markets. These represent pieces that show minor wear but maintain their essential design integrity. Mid-range pricing ($150-$200) applies to pins in excellent condition with original packaging, representing the sweet spot for most collectors seeking quality without premium pricing.

High-end pricing ($250-$300+) reflects pieces with exceptional provenance, such as pins distributed directly to Olympic athletes or media personnel. These command premium prices due to their documented connection to actual Olympic events. Seasonal pricing trends show increased demand during Olympic years, with prices often spiking during major Olympic coverage or Snoop Dogg media appearances.

Factors Driving Price Variations

Edition scarcity plays the most significant role in determining value, with lower-numbered pieces commanding higher prices. Athletic provenance adds substantial value, particularly pins documented as having been distributed to specific Olympic athletes. Authentication documentation significantly impacts pricing, with pieces accompanied by certificates of authenticity or blockchain verification commanding premium values.

Physical Authentication Markers

Enamel quality assessment requires examining color consistency, surface smoothness, and edge definition. Authentic pins demonstrate superior craftsmanship with vibrant colors that maintain uniformity across the entire surface. The enamel should feel smooth without rough patches or visible air bubbles that characterize lower-quality reproductions.

Official branding elements include specific font styles, proportional accuracy in the Olympic rings, and precise color matching that adheres to official Olympic standards. Common counterfeit indicators include poor enamel work with visible inconsistencies, lightweight metal construction, and inaccurate color reproduction in the Olympic rings.

Step-by-Step Purchasing Process

Successful acquisition requires a systematic approach that balances enthusiasm with careful verification. Following established procedures protects your investment and ensures a positive collecting experience.

Pre-Purchase Research and Security

Begin with comprehensive seller verification, examining feedback ratings, transaction history, and specialization in collectibles. Established sellers typically maintain detailed profiles with specific expertise areas and customer testimonials. Price comparison methodology involves checking completed sales across multiple platforms to establish current market values for similar items.

Payment security requires using protected methods like PayPal Goods and Services or credit cards with fraud protection. Avoid wire transfers or money orders unless using established platforms with built-in buyer protection.

Shipping and Buyer Protection

Packaging requirements should include protective padding, rigid backing to prevent bending, and weather-resistant outer packaging. Insurance coverage becomes essential for higher-value pins, protecting against loss or damage during transit. Return policies vary among platforms, with most reputable sources offering 30-day return windows for items that don’t match descriptions.
